Abstract
A multi-functional hand tool comprises a hand tool body which has a handle; each of two ends of the handle having a connecting unit for connecting various assembly so that the hand tool has various functions. At least one connecting unit is formed with a recess. At least one connecting unit is formed with a polygonal connection portion. The handle is formed with a pivotal portion. The pivotal portion is installed at one third of the handle.

Referring to FIGS. 1 to 4(J)4, the multi-functional hand tool of the present invention is illustrated. The multi-functional hand tool has the following elements.


A hand tool body 1 has a handle 10. Each of two ends of the handle 10 has a connecting unit 11. The shape of the connecting unit 11 is not confined. In this embodiment, the connecting unit 11 is formed with an insertion hole 11 which has a shape illustrated in FIGS. 4(A) to 4(J). In one example, referring to FIG. 4, each of two ends of the handle 10 having a connecting unit for connecting various assembly so that the handle tool has various functions and thus the handle have two connecting units at two ends thereof. One connecting unit is formed with a recess; wherein a recess is an approximate round recess with six “custom character” shape grooves arranged around an edge of the recess (see FIG. 4(H)) and another connecting unit of the handle is formed with a pentagonal recess (see FIG. 4(J)).


The application of the present invention is illustrated in FIGS. 5 and 8. A driving head 21 can be installed in the insertion hole 111. The driving head 21 may be a ratchet driving head 21 (referring to FIG. 5-1), an opened end driving head 21 (referring to FIG. 5-2), a socket driving head 21 (referring to FIG. 5-3), etc. Thus the multi-functional hand tool can be used with various driving heads 21 by using the insertion holes 111 at two ends thereof.


Referring to FIGS. 6 and 7, the present invention can be used with different kinds of opener heads 22, 23. In FIG. 7, a T shape auxiliary rotating unit 23 is inserted into the insertion hole 111 at one end of the multi-functional hand tool (referring to FIG. 8) so as to provide a long arm of force. Thereby the multi-functional hand tool can be used to drive an object easily.


Referring to FIGS. 9 and 10, another embodiment of the present invention is illustrated. Those identical to the first embodiment will not be described herein. Only those differences are described herein. In this embodiment, the connecting unit 11 of the present invention can be realized as a polygonal connecting unit 112 for being connected to a socket or an auxiliary rotating unit 23, etc. so as to achieve the object of multi-function.


With reference to FIGS. 11 and 12, a further embodiment of the multi-functional hand tool of the present invention is illustrated. Those identical to the first embodiment will not be described herein. Only those differences are described herein. In this embodiment, the handle 10 is formed with a pivotal portion 12 so that the two connecting units 11 at two ends of the multi-functional hand tool can be pivotally rotated with respect to one another. Thereby the multi-functional hand tool can be used to various conditions. In FIG. 12, it is illustrated that a screw mean is inserted into the insertion hole 111 of the connecting unit 11. It is preferable that the pivotal portion 12 is installed at one third of the handle 10.
